You don't actually need the datfile in order to dump games. Also, in case you can't get the datfile from Redump, CleanRip lets you download a Wii datfile that's publicly hosted on a different server. The only problem with not having the datfile is that you won't know whether something is a new dump or verification, but that little problem can be handled by whoever is adding your dump to the database. It's safe to assume that essentially any Wii disc you dump (as long as it's not listed here) is a verification, though.

The dumper status is granted once you have dumped a few games. The number of dumps you've submitted this far should be sufficient – you'll just have to wait for them to get added.
